Java实现文本写入,轻松实现批量写入文本文件

在Java编程中,经常需要对文本文件进行读写操作。而在实际开发中,有时需要将大量数据写入到文本文件中,此时就需要进行批量写入操作。本文将介绍如何使用。

Java实现文本写入,轻松实现批量写入文本文件

一、使用Java实现文本写入

在Java中,可以使用FileWriter类实现文本写入操作。FileWriter类是Writer类的子类,用于写入字符流。以下是使用FileWriter类实现文本写入的示例代码

```javaport java.io.FileWriter;port;

aing[] args) {ull;

try {ew FileWriter("test.txt");

writer.write("Hello,World!"); ally {ull) {

try {

writer.close();

}

}

}

}

ally块中关闭文件流。

二、实现批量写入文本文件

如果需要将大量数据写入到文本文件中,那么使用上述方式逐个写入数据会显得十分繁琐。此时,可以使用BufferedWriter类实现批量写入操作。BufferedWriter类是Writer类的子类,用于缓存写入字符流。以下是使用BufferedWriter类实现批量写入操作的示例代码

```javaport java.io.BufferedWriter;port java.io.FileWriter;port;

aing[] args) {ull;

try {ewew FileWriter("test.txt"));t i = 0; i < 10000; i++) {");

} ally {ull) {

try {

writer.close();

}

}

}

}

ally块中关闭文件流。

本文介绍了如何使用Java实现文本写入操作,以及如何使用BufferedWriter类实现批量写入文本文件操作。在实际开发中,我们可以根据具体需求选择不同的方法进行文本写入操作。希望本文能够对大家有所帮助。

相关文章

HashMap是Java中最常用的集合类框架,也是Java语言中非常典型...
在EffectiveJava中的第 36条中建议 用 EnumSet 替代位字段,...
介绍 注解是JDK1.5版本开始引入的一个特性,用于对代码进行说...
介绍 LinkedList同时实现了List接口和Deque接口,也就是说它...
介绍 TreeSet和TreeMap在Java里有着相同的实现,前者仅仅是对...
HashMap为什么线程不安全 put的不安全 由于多线程对HashMap进...